If you owe, we will send a bill for the amount due, including any penalties and interest. WebThis is the first letter in a collection series. It should contain a short message to gently remind the customer that payment is past due. The message could be attached to the bottom of a billing statement and could acknowledge that payment may have already been made. How to write this collection letter:

WebJul 12, 2024 · Updated July 12, 2024. A current rent balance letter is sent from a landlord to a tenant to inform of any past due or monies owed from non-payment of rent or other money owed. The letter is meant to be a formal message to the tenant stating they owe money to the landlord with language stating that the next letter will be an eviction notice …
